It is short, reproducible, valid and sensitive to … WebThe Oxford Shoulder Score (OSS) consists of 12 questionnaire items with 5 ordinal response options each. Recall period “during the last 4 weeks” (Dawson et al., 1996 ). Scoring: each item 0–4 (4 = best/least problems). All item scores summed to produce scale 0–48 (48 = best/least problems).

The Oxford Shoulder Score (OSS) is a 12-item patient-reported PRO specifically designed and developed for assessing outcomes of shoulder surgery e.g. for assessing the impact on patients’ quality of life of degenerative conditions such as arthritis and rotator cuff problems. WebNov 14, 2013 · The OSS was developed in Oxford (UK) by Dawson et al. [ 31] for patients with shoulder problems. It contains 12 items related to pain and shoulder function. There are five response options for each question, corresponding to a score ranging from 1 (least difficult) to 5 (most difficult). WebMay 15, 2008 · Oxford Shoulder Score (OSS) is a self-report questionnaire developed for patients having shoulder disease other than instability, and consists of 12 questions about pain and disability . Respondents report their pain or difficulty in completing a task by circling a number from 1 to 5 with verbal anchors following each number.
